📝 Ingredients
Water, Organic Apple Cider Vinegar, Maple Syrup, Ginger Juice, Apple Juice Concentrate, Chicory Root, Ginger Puree, Monk Fruit Extract.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ger
Is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ger good for weight loss?
At 71 calories per serving, this drink is relatively light, but the 14g of sugar means most of the carbs come from sweeteners rather than filling fiber. While the 5g of fiber helps, you'd want to be mindful of the sugar content if weight loss is your goal.
How does the fiber in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ger support digestion?
The 5g of fiber in each serving supports digestion by promoting healthy gut movement and feeding beneficial bacteria. This amount is substantial for a beverage and helps keep you satisfied between meals.
Is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ger a good snack for kids?
Kids may enjoy the maple-ginger flavor, but the acidity from apple cider vinegar makes it better suited for older children and adults. Diluting it further or offering it as an occasional treat rather than a regular drink is the safest approach for younger kids.
What diets does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ger suit?
This drink works well for high-fiber diets and suits people interested in apple cider vinegar wellness trends. It's also compatible with most plant-based and whole-food-focused eating patterns.
What should I watch out for with Switchel Apple Cider Vinegar Drink, Mapleginger?
The sugar content (14g per serving) is the main thing to monitor, especially if you're watching your intake. Apple cider vinegar drinks can also be acidic, so sipping through a straw and rinsing your mouth afterward helps protect tooth enamel.
